The Science Behind Cold Laser Treatment for Pet Dogs: Exploring Its Recovery Features and Applications
Cold laser therapy for dogs utilizes low-level laser light to advertise healing and minimize pain. This technique focuses on details wavelengths that enhance mobile functions, specifically in mitochondria. By enhancing ATP manufacturing, it aids in minimizing inflammation and speeding up cells repair service. Pain Relief System
Laser treatment successfully minimizes discomfort in pets by making use of specific wavelengths of light that penetrate the skin and stimulate cellular task. This procedure advertises the release of endorphins and decreases inflammation, offering a non-invasive choice to typical discomfort monitoring approaches. The light sent out during therapy communicates with the mitochondria in cells, enhancing their power manufacturing and facilitating the fixing of broken cells. Consequently, canines experience minimized discomfort from conditions such as joint inflammation, post-surgical discomfort, and soft cells injuries. In addition, chilly laser therapy is well-tolerated, making it ideal for dogs of all ages and sizes. This ingenious method to pain alleviation uses family pet owners a effective and risk-free method to improve their pet's lifestyle.

The Treatment Process: What to Anticipate
After comprehending the problems that chilly laser therapy can deal with, pet proprietors may wonder concerning the treatment procedure itself. Commonly, the initial step entails an appointment with a vet, that will review the dog's condition and determine if chilly laser therapy is appropriate. When authorized, the therapy sessions can begin, normally lasting in between 5 to 20 mins, depending upon the location being dealt with and the seriousness of the condition.
During the session, the dog may be positioned conveniently, and the laser tool will be related to the damaged area. The laser gives off low-level light that passes through the skin, promoting mobile repair work and lowering inflammation. A lot of pets tolerate the treatment well, frequently showing up loosened up and even sleepy. Complying with the initial sessions, family pet proprietors might discover renovations in mobility, pain decrease, and total well-being, with follow-up sees set up to keep track of development and readjust therapy as needed.

Possible Side Impacts
While cool laser treatment is typically pertained to as risk-free for pets, potential side results should be thought about. Some pets may experience moderate pain during or after therapy, including local warmth or tingling experiences. Seldom, short-lived swelling or redness at the application website might occur, which commonly deals with promptly. Allergies to the laser light or involved devices are possible but uncommon. It is likewise critical to monitor canines with particular clinical problems, such as those with light level of sensitivity or specific cancers cells, as they might not respond well to this treatment. Consulting a vet prior to initiating treatment assurances that prospective dangers are examined and managed efficiently, optimizing the advantages while reducing any kind of unfavorable results.
Treatment Procedure Guidelines
Establishing effective treatment method standards is vital for optimizing the safety and security and efficacy of cool laser treatment in canines. Specialists need to perform detailed evaluations, taking into consideration variables such as the canine's age, weight, and certain health and wellness conditions. Therapy duration and regularity have to be tailored to the private animal, usually ranging from 5 to 30 minutes per session, with sessions set up one to 3 times per week. The suitable laser wavelength, usually in between 600 to 1000 nanometers, must be chosen for perfect tissue infiltration and restorative effect. In addition, keeping track of the dog's reaction during and after therapies is important, permitting modifications in procedure as needed. Following these standards guarantees a methodical method, boosting healing outcomes while lessening potential dangers.
